Pros:
- First of all, mainly it is a MMO mouse, but buttons can programmable for any task. Easy to customize.
- Some people say hard to reach side buttons. Actually, this is the main problem for any MMO mouse (12 buttons). But key slider works for me. I didn't expect it would work. I got used to reach "all" 12 side buttons. I was thinking to use only 9 buttons before buy it. (This comment only about reaching buttons, not about texture on it. Check cons please) But reaching last three buttons (10-11-12) can be hard (sometimes impossible or isn't practical) on any MMO mouse. Keep in your mind before buy any mouse like that.
- Software is good in my opinion.
- RGB Leds. Easy to change for any setup you want. e.g. I don't like any light source that comes directly to screen (or distract me) in a dark room while I watch movie. I created a profile that turns off the leds when media player starts. It's a basic example but sometimes basic problems can be annoying.
Cons:
- Texture on side buttons would be more noticeable. Easy to click different button on the action.
- Reaching last three buttons can be hard. Key slider helps, but depends of hand/finger size.
Overall Review: - I have been using it for 6-7 months, and I haven't encountered any problem yet like double clicking or non-working buttons. If I encounter double clicking problem, all my comment/rating will be changed. Double-clicking is not acceptable problem. I can't ignore it. Of course I don't expect that it works stable 100 years.
Pros:
The grip textures are great and well placed.
These gaming mice with all their buttons are great for mmorpgs. The grip textures on the scimitar feel great. The textures on the thumb keys are also alternated allowing you to easily know which buttons you are on. I've used the logitech g6 and razer naga in the past and this corsair scimitar has the best designed thumb keys. I also think because of how easy to grip the scimitar is I won't need to swap mice when i play fps like i used to.
Cons: no cons yet but I'm writing this at day one.
